C/C++ 通过ADO对数据库操作
实例:c++ 通过ADO调用存储过程写入数据到sql server

1.在.h头文件导入微软提供的ado的动态库
#pragma warning(disable:4146)
#import "C:\\Program Files\\Common Files\\System\\ado\\msado15.dll" named_guids rename("EOF","adoEOF"), rename("BOF","adoBOF")
#pragma warning(default:4146)
using namespace ADODB;

2.编写函数调用存储过程
//保存数据库记录
void SaveDbTran(char *devID,char * traceNo,char *refNo,char *batchNo, char * bankCardNo, char * tranDate, char * tranTime,char * amt,char * hosCardNo,char * hosName,char * hosIDCardNo, char *msg)
{

//2.1创建数据库连接句柄
_ConnectionPtr pMyConnect;
HRESULT hr;

try
{
//2.1.1组建连接数据库字符串
char *dbConStr = new char[400];
strcpy(dbConStr,"Provider=SQLOLEDB;Server=sqlserver服务器地址,1433;Database=数据库名;uid=登陆用户;pwd=登录密码");

CoInitialize(NULL);

Sleep(300);
//2.1.2 句柄实例化 实现连接
hr = pMyConnect.CreateInstance("ADODB.Connection");
if(SUCCEEDED(hr))
{
ct.SaveLog("创建数据库连接对象成功,等待打开连接",0,dbConStr);
pMyConnect->Open(_bstr_t(dbConStr),"","",adModeUnknown);

}
else
{
CoUninitialize();
return;
}
}
catch(_com_error &err)
{

CoUninitialize();
return ;
}
//2.2组建运行命令参数句柄
_CommandPtr m_pCommand;
_RecordsetPtr m_pRecordset;
try
{
//2.2.1 句柄实例化
m_pCommand.CreateInstance(__uuidof(Command));//Command无需改变
m_pCommand->ActiveConnection = pMyConnect;//pMyConnect 为连接数据库句柄
m_pCommand->CommandType = adCmdStoredProc;//adCmdStoredProc无需改变
m_pCommand->CommandText = _bstr_t("p_d_tra");//p_d_tra为存储过程名

//2.2.2 设置给可变参数赋值
_variant_t vv_dotype,vv_TranNo,vv_devID,vv_TranDate,vv_TranTime;
_variant_t vv_RetCode,vv_BusType,vv_CardNo,vv_IDCard,vv_Name;
_variant_t vv_Amt,vv_Notes,vv_SerID,vv_DesCont,vv_tranFlag;
_variant_t vv_bankCardNo,vv_bankGroupNo,vv_bankFlowNo,vv_DevName,vv_ExeCount;
// value to variant
vv_dotype =_variant_t(_bstr_t("1"));
vv_TranNo =_variant_t(_bstr_t(temp_traceNo));
vv_devID =_variant_t(_bstr_t(devID));
vv_TranDate =_variant_t(_bstr_t(datetime));
vv_TranTime =_variant_t(_bstr_t(datetime));
vv_RetCode =_variant_t(_bstr_t(""));
vv_BusType =_variant_t(_bstr_t("14"));
vv_CardNo =_variant_t(_bstr_t(hosCardNo));
vv_IDCard =_variant_t(_bstr_t(hosIDCardNo));

vv_Name = _variant_t(_bstr_t(hosName));
vv_Amt =_variant_t(_bstr_t(amt));
vv_Notes =_variant_t(_bstr_t("交易成功"));
vv_SerID =_variant_t(_bstr_t(""));
vv_DesCont =_variant_t(_bstr_t(""));
vv_tranFlag =_variant_t(_bstr_t("0"));
vv_bankCardNo =_variant_t(_bstr_t(temp_bankCardNo));
vv_bankGroupNo=_variant_t(_bstr_t(batchNo));
vv_bankFlowNo =_variant_t(_bstr_t(refNo));
vv_DevName =_variant_t(_bstr_t(""));
vv_ExeCount = _variant_t(ret_ExeCount);

//2.2.3创建数据库存储过程输入参数
_ParameterPtr mp_dotype,mp_TranNo,mp_devID,mp_TranDate,mp_TranTime;
_ParameterPtr mp_RetCode,mp_BusType,mp_CardNo,mp_IDCard,mp_Name;
_ParameterPtr mp_Amt,mp_Notes,mp_SerID,mp_DesCont,mp_tranFlag;
_ParameterPtr mp_bankCardNo,mp_bankGroupNo,mp_bankFlowNo,mp_DevName,mp_ExeCount;

//2.2.3.1给数据库参数实例化
//create ParameterPtr instance
mp_dotype.CreateInstance(__uuidof(Parameter));
mp_TranNo.CreateInstance(__uuidof(Parameter));
mp_devID.CreateInstance(__uuidof(Parameter));
mp_TranDate.CreateInstance(__uuidof(Parameter));
mp_TranTime.CreateInstance(__uuidof(Parameter));
mp_RetCode.CreateInstance(__uuidof(Parameter));
mp_BusType.CreateInstance(__uuidof(Parameter));
mp_CardNo.CreateInstance(__uuidof(Parameter));
mp_IDCard.CreateInstance(__uuidof(Parameter));
mp_Name.CreateInstance(__uuidof(Parameter));
mp_Amt.CreateInstance(__uuidof(Parameter));
mp_Notes.CreateInstance(__uuidof(Parameter));
mp_SerID.CreateInstance(__uuidof(Parameter));
mp_DesCont.CreateInstance(__uuidof(Parameter));
mp_tranFlag.CreateInstance(__uuidof(Parameter));
mp_bankCardNo.CreateInstance(__uuidof(Parameter));
mp_bankGroupNo.CreateInstance(__uuidof(Parameter));
mp_bankFlowNo.CreateInstance(__uuidof(Parameter));
mp_DevName.CreateInstance(__uuidof(Parameter));
mp_ExeCount.CreateInstance(__uuidof(Parameter));

//2.2.3.2将数据库参数追加到 命令变量句柄的参数属性末尾
//append parameterPtr set to _CommandPtr parameters lists
//数据库参数 = 命令变量句柄->创建参数方法(_bstr_t("存储过程参数名"),存储过程参数数据类型,存储过程参数输入输出类型,默认大小,可变参数值)
mp_dotype=m_pCommand->CreateParameter(_bstr_t("dotype"),adInteger,adParamInput,-1,vv_dotype);//整数类型
m_pCommand->Parameters->Append(mp_dotype);

mp_TranNo=m_pCommand->CreateParameter(_bstr_t("TranNo"),adVarChar,adParamInput,32,vv_TranNo); //字符串类型
m_pCommand->Parameters->Append(mp_TranNo);

mp_devID=m_pCommand->CreateParameter(_bstr_t("devID"),adVarChar,adParamInput,20,vv_devID);
m_pCommand->Parameters->Append(mp_devID);

mp_TranDate=m_pCommand->CreateParameter(_bstr_t("TranDate"),adVarChar,adParamInput,25,vv_TranDate);//时间类型
m_pCommand->Parameters->Append(mp_TranDate);

mp_TranTime=m_pCommand->CreateParameter(_bstr_t("TranTime"),adVarChar,adParamInput,25,vv_TranTime);
m_pCommand->Parameters->Append(mp_TranTime);

mp_RetCode=m_pCommand->CreateParameter(_bstr_t("RetCode"),adVarChar,adParamInput,20,vv_RetCode);
m_pCommand->Parameters->Append(mp_RetCode);

mp_BusType=m_pCommand->CreateParameter(_bstr_t("BusType"),adInteger,adParamInput,-1,vv_BusType);
m_pCommand->Parameters->Append(mp_BusType);

mp_CardNo=m_pCommand->CreateParameter(_bstr_t("CardNo"),adVarChar,adParamInput,20,vv_CardNo);
m_pCommand->Parameters->Append(mp_CardNo);

mp_IDCard=m_pCommand->CreateParameter(_bstr_t("IDCard"),adVarChar,adParamInput,20,vv_IDCard);
m_pCommand->Parameters->Append(mp_IDCard);

mp_Name=m_pCommand->CreateParameter(_bstr_t("Name"),adVarChar,adParamInput,10,vv_Name);
m_pCommand->Parameters->Append(mp_Name);

mp_Amt=m_pCommand->CreateParameter(_bstr_t("Amt"),adDecimal,adParamInput,10,vv_Amt);//浮点数类型
mp_Amt->NumericScale = 2; //设置小数点后位数
mp_Amt->Precision = 10; //设置整数位位数
m_pCommand->Parameters->Append(mp_Amt);

mp_Notes=m_pCommand->CreateParameter(_bstr_t("Notes"),adVarChar,adParamInput,2000,vv_Notes);
m_pCommand->Parameters->Append(mp_Notes);

mp_SerID=m_pCommand->CreateParameter(_bstr_t("SerID"),adVarChar,adParamInput,20,vv_SerID);
m_pCommand->Parameters->Append(mp_SerID);

mp_DesCont=m_pCommand->CreateParameter(_bstr_t("DesCont"),adVarChar,adParamInput,2000,vv_DesCont);
m_pCommand->Parameters->Append(mp_DesCont);

mp_tranFlag=m_pCommand->CreateParameter(_bstr_t("tranFlag"),adInteger,adParamInput,-1,vv_tranFlag);
m_pCommand->Parameters->Append(mp_tranFlag);

mp_bankCardNo=m_pCommand->CreateParameter(_bstr_t("bankCardNo"),adVarChar,adParamInput,25,vv_bankCardNo);
m_pCommand->Parameters->Append(mp_bankCardNo);

mp_bankGroupNo=m_pCommand->CreateParameter(_bstr_t("bankGroupNo"),adVarChar,adParamInput,12,vv_bankGroupNo);
m_pCommand->Parameters->Append(mp_bankGroupNo);

mp_bankFlowNo=m_pCommand->CreateParameter(_bstr_t("bankFlowNo"),adVarChar,adParamInput,12,vv_bankFlowNo);
m_pCommand->Parameters->Append(mp_bankFlowNo);

mp_DevName=m_pCommand->CreateParameter(_bstr_t("DevName"),adVarChar,adParamInput,40,vv_DevName);
m_pCommand->Parameters->Append(mp_DevName);

mp_ExeCount=m_pCommand->CreateParameter(_bstr_t("ExeCount"),adInteger,adParamOutput,-1,vv_ExeCount);//输出类型
m_pCommand->Parameters->Append(mp_ExeCount);

//2.2.4 执行得到结果
_variant_t vNull;
vNull.vt = VT_ERROR;
vNull.scode = DISP_E_PARAMNOTFOUND;
//2.2.4.1执行数据库存储过程
m_pRecordset = m_pCommand->Execute(&vNull,&vNull,adCmdStoredProc);//adCmdStoredProc不要改变
//m_pRecordset执行SQL结果 可对其进行判断确定成功,错误原因

if (mp_ExeCount->Value != 0)
{
ct.SaveLog("插入数据失败",0,"");
}
else
{
ct.SaveLog("插入数据成功",0,"");
}
}
catch(_com_error &err)
{
if(pMyConnect->State) pMyConnect->Close();
pMyConnect = NULL;
CoUninitialize();

}

//2.2.5 关闭连接 释放资源
if(pMyConnect->State) pMyConnect->Close();
pMyConnect = NULL;
CoUninitialize(); //切记成功与否都要调用 以释放资源

return ;

}
